His Beatitude Patriarch John X Celebrates the Sunday Divine Liturgy of the third week of Lent (Sunday of the Veneration of the Holy Cross) at the Church of the Holy Cross in Qassa'a, Damascus

Damascus, April 7

His Beatitude Patriarch John X, Greek Orthodox Patriarch of Antioch and All the East, and President of the Middle East Council of Churches for the Orthodox Family, celebrated the Sunday Divine Liturgy of the third week of Lent (Sunday of the Veneration of the Holy Cross) at the Church of the Holy Cross in Qassa'a, Damascus, with the participation of their Graces, Bishops: Romanos (Al-Hannat), Moussa (Al-Khoury), Ioannis (Batach), Arsanios (Dahdal), and Moses (Al-Khosi), along with several priests and deacons. At the end of the Divine Liturgy, the procession with the Holy Cross took place, and the faithful received blessings from it. After the Divine Liturgy, His Beatitude Patriarch John X headed to the Association of St. Gregory the Orthodox for Orphan Care and Elderly Support, inaugurating a new hall in the center with the efforts of those in charge.
